    Artist History
    When Louis sings "I was born in Amarillo with the honky tonks and the rodeos" it's the truth. He was born Louis Anthony Homen, the youngest of six boys raised in Amarillo, Texas in a large, close-knit family. Like his autobiographical song "Amarillo Bound", his summers were spent on a John Deere tractor helping with the family farm. When he wasn't farming, he was playing his guitar and lining up gigs. He started off as a solo act at a barn dance and never looked back. Louis graduated with a degree in Geology from West Texas A&M University, married Alice Hill and moved to Dallas where he pursued his environmental consulting career. With his band days on hold for a while, he started is own company, LH Environmental Consulting, Inc., which grew to become a leading environmental consulting firm in North Texas. Louis sold the business in 2003 and now he is devoting his time to singing and songwriting. After seven years and two miscarriages, Louis and Alice were truly blessed with the birth of their daughter, Chelsea and even more blessed and surprised by the birth of their second daughter, Meredith one year later. Louis wrote the song "By the Faith" after Chelsea was born so they would always remember their faith in God led them to such a happy and glorious day. In addition to quality family time, Louis enjoys writing, promoting his music, bass fishing and playing golf. Homen recorded Never Too Late which was released in December of 2002. This 13 track CD of Texas music is a great mix of traditional country, folk and Americana music with lyrics that are from the heart, offering something for everyone.
